#0d3835 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0d3835 is composed of 5.1% red, 22%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.4% yellow and 78% black. It has a hue angle of 175.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 13.5%. #0d3835 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a706a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#0d3835 color description : Very dark cyan.

#0d3835 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0d3835 has RGB values of R:13, G:56,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 866357.

Shades and Tints of #0d3835

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020808 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d3835

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222323 is the less saturated color, while #02433e is the most saturated one.
